ICB Network, a Web3 innovative blockchain for speed and safety, has strategically announced its partnership with Stability World AI, a generative AI platform merging AI agents with blockchain incentives. The partnership is aimed at boosting the earning infrastructure with a ‘Hold-to-Earn’ model and a platform containing 72000 active users.

Both partners have certain specific qualities and features that help to maintain their status in this digital world with dignity. For this, ICB Network has a system of proof-of-Stake (PoS) that provides facilities in terms of efficiency, security, and scalability. Furthermore, Stability World AI has also earned a reputation in the industry for its performance in merging AI with blockchain. ICB Network has released this news via its official X account.

ICB Network and Stability World AI Set to Launch Hold-to-Earn Model

The basic focus of the alliance of ICB Network and Stability World AI is to improve the ways of earning for their users by utilizing their special services. Moreover, both platforms are also searching for the platform that has 72000 active users for the expansion of their services by joining that platform.

One of the most important aspects of this collaboration is to create a well-known model, ‘Hold-to-Earn’, that will certainly help users by protecting their assets and earnings. In this model, users can easily generate their passive income or reward by purchasing and maintaining a certain cryptocurrency in their digital wallet.

Blockchain industry participants and regulators continue wrangling over privacy rights as the European Union’s sweeping Anti-Money Laundering (AML) rules look set to ban privacy-preserving tokens and anonymous crypto accounts starting in 2027. Credit institutions, financial institutions and crypto asset service providers (CASPs) will be prohibited from maintaining anonymous accounts or handling privacy-preserving cryptocurrencies under the EU’s new Anti-Money Laundering Regulation (AMLR) that will go into effect in 2027, Cointelegraph reported in May. Maintaining the right to access privacy-preserving coins like Monero (XMR) has been a “constant battle” between blockchain industry stakeholders and regulators, according to Anja Blaj, an independent legal consultant and policy expert at the European Crypto Initiative. “Once you think of how the states want to play out their policies, they want to establish control. They want to understand who the parties are that transact among themselves,” said Blaj, speaking during Cointelegraph’s daily live X spaces show on Sept. 3. “[The state] wants to understand that to be able to prevent whatever crime and scamming is happening, and we want to enforce the policies that we create as a society.” Her comments came as the EU ramped up its regulatory oversight of the crypto industry, building on the bloc’s Markets in Crypto-Assets Regulation (MiCA). Related: Swiss banks complete first blockchain-based legally binding payment Room for negotiation remains While the AML framework is final, regulatory experts still see potential for negotiation until it rolls out in 2027. Policymaking is a “continuous conversation,” meaning that “nothing is set in stone, even if the regulation is already out,” said Blaj. “There are still ways to either talk to the regulators, see how it’s going to play out, how it’s going to be enforced.” While there’s always room for negotiations with policymakers, the regulation concerning privacy-preserving cryptocurrencies and accounts is becoming “more…
